AUBURN -- Reese Dismukes is one of 12 semifinalists for the Rotary Lombardi Award as the top interior lineman or linebacker in college football.

Auburn's senior center is one of two offensive players and 10 players among the 12 semifinalists for the award, which will be presented Dec. 10, 2014, at Bayou Music Center in Houston, Texas.

The SEC and Pac-12 Conference each have four players each, followed by the Big Ten with three players, the ACC with one player.

The Rotary Lombardi Selection Committee is comprised of more than 300 members, including all past winners and finalists, all Division I head coaches and a panel of sportswriters and broadcasters.

Pittsburgh defensive end Aaron Donald won the award last season.

The 12 semifinalists are:

Vic Beasley DE Sr Clemson
Joey Bosa DE So Ohio State
Shilique Calhoun DE Jr Michigan State
Reese Dismukes C Sr Auburn
Hau'oli Kikaha LB Sr Washington
Benardrick McKinney LB Jr Mississippi State
Robert Nkemdiche DT So Ole Miss
Nate Orchard DE Sr Utah
Shane Ray DE Jr Missouri
Brandon Scherff T Sr Iowa
Leonard Williams DE Jr USC
Scooby Wright LB So Arizona
